hey man you may want to try raise the ride height first to see how the jumps feel, as you have it now i bet you corner great and with good speed but you may bottom out off of jumps you are very low to the ground so mayb try like 29 rear and 30-31 front, you will still have good steering with this and hopefully less bottom out if any at all if you downside em lol. you may also want to stiffen the rear oil just a tad like mayb 30 and place the shock in on the arm on the rear, this too will help in how the truck soak up bumps as well. idk what diff out means, if you tell me then mayb i can help cause i have had diff probs in the past bro and had to learn how to fix em over and over again the hard way dnt wnt that to happen to anyone else and good luck in ur tuning bro
